Moskal as a harbinger of Poroshenko’s problems
The media continue to discuss the information that appeared in the media about the statement written by Gennady Moskal about his resignation from the post of head of the Transcarpathian regional administration

Thus, Rossiyskaya Gazeta notes that it is not known for certain whether such a statement, information about which appeared in the Ukrainian media with reference to sources in the presidential administration, actually took place.
“The same sources told them that Poroshenko did not satisfy Moskal’s application,” the newspaper continues. – At the same time, Moskal published a demand for the president to dismiss the head of the local election headquarters of the BPP and the head of the party organization, Verkhovna Rada deputy Valery Patskan. Moskal accused him of bribing voters, working for the oligarch Konstantin Zhevago from the rival Batkivshchyna party, and of provocations against the governor.”
It is possible that Moskal is blamed for the unsatisfactory result of the president’s party in local elections in Transcarpathia.
“And only in the elections to the Uzhgorod City Council the BPP showed a decent result, but even this, according to independent observers, was the result of direct bribery and fraud,” RG points out. – Actually, this is exactly what ex-General Moskal is accusing Patskan of the head of the BPP election headquarters today. Evil tongues claim that by posing the question bluntly to Poroshenko – “either he or I” – Moskal wants to preserve the image of a truth-teller and a fighter against corruption before his inevitable departure. In addition, he did not hide his desire to head the Kyiv or the entire National Police. But this position went to a hitherto unknown Georgian Khatia Dekanoidze. And that means Moskal had a reason to be offended by Poroshenko.”
“No matter how the story with Moskal’s resignation ends, Petro Poroshenko turns out to be the victim,” the publication summarizes. – If only because in his political biography Moskal has already left Viktor Yushchenko, Yulia Tymoshenko, Arseniy Yatsenyuk with a scandal. And this was always a harbinger of big problems and a decline in the political status of his former patrons, in other words, a sure sign.”
